Output 38ac390600399fcf3c30a19a8839b0239e119f6468505bff4c6b5ce5fda1a30a:2

value
28764700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f279b9b1520ca5858e5d3bfaa25ea16526a97a3e OP_EQUALVERIFY OP_CHECKSIG
address
1P76M3s7y5vVyvHZv1B3NfE1nNZFYGUBnm
transaction
38ac390600399fcf3c30a19a8839b0239e119f6468505bff4c6b5ce5fda1a30a
spent
true